Serious golfers rejoice! The RoboCup Golf Ball Return Robot makes practicing your putting quick, fun, and painless.
As golfing fanatics will attest, putting accounts for half (or more) of all strokes in a round of golf. Yet, most golfers avoid the practice green like the plague because practicing putting can be boring and tedious. Thanks to the RoboCup, putting can be fun!
The RoboCup Ball Return Robot fits into either practice or full-depth cups and automatically returns your ball up to fourteen feet. With the included Caddy Cord, even missed putts will be returned to you.
One set of 4 AA batteries (not included) will last for up to 12,000 ball returns. Includes a padded carrying case.

Article "A robot hit a hole-in-one and everyone celebrated like it was a human"In the opening round of the 2016 Waste Management Phoenix Open, LDRIC the golf robot gets a hole-in-one on the par-3 16th hole.
